>백엔드 개발 >C++ >Psapi.lib와 같은 외부 라이브러리를 Qt Creator 프로젝트에 어떻게 통합합니까?

Psapi.lib와 같은 외부 라이브러리를 Qt Creator 프로젝트에 어떻게 통합합니까?

Mary-Kate Olsen
Mary-Kate Olsen원래의
2024-12-15 16:23:14907검색

How Do I Integrate External Libraries Like Psapi.lib into My Qt Creator Projects?

Qt Creator 프로젝트에 외부 라이브러리 통합

Qt Creator RC1에서 만든 프로젝트에 외부 라이브러리를 추가하는 것은 기본 기능 이상의 추가 기능에 액세스하는 데 필수적입니다. Qt 라이브러리. EnumProcesses() 함수에 액세스하기 위해 Psapi.lib 라이브러리를 통합하는 예를 사용하여 이를 달성하는 방법을 살펴보겠습니다.

외부 라이브러리를 원활하게 통합하려면 다음 권장 접근 방식을 따르세요.

LIBS += -L/path/to -lpsapi

이 방법은 라이브러리 디렉터리를 이름에서 효과적으로 분리합니다(확장자 및 "lib" 접두사 제외). 이는 Qt 지원 플랫폼 간의 호환성을 보장합니다.

또는 프로젝트 디렉토리에 저장된 라이브러리의 경우 $$_PRO_FILE_PWD_ 변수를 사용하여 참조할 수 있습니다.

LIBS += -L"$$_PRO_FILE_PWD_/3rdparty/libs/" -lpsapi

경로 및 이러한 방식으로 라이브러리 이름을 지정하면 외부 라이브러리에 액세스하고 Qt Creator 프로젝트 내에서 해당 기능을 잠금 해제할 수 있습니다.

위 내용은 Psapi.lib와 같은 외부 라이브러리를 Qt Creator 프로젝트에 어떻게 통합합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.